Geos, do you have OpenSUSE 10.3?

If you don't add any additional repositories, yast will present you what's on the installation media.
By the time of making 10.3 this was Wesnoth 1.2 as the current stable version.

Just take a look here to get the newest stuff for OpenSUSE:
http://www.wesnoth.org/wiki/WesnothBina ... F_OpenSUSE

For 10.3, use the OneClick-Install link, choose wesnoth 1.4 (or the editor) and you are done.
